“…CDIL metal NP catalysts can be also prepared in situ by decomposition/reduction of organometallic precursors or metal complexes, laser ablation, , or sputtering deposition. ,,,, In sputtering deposition, the size of the metal NPs can be modulated by the sputtering conditions. ,,,, In the chemical method, the size of MNPs is preferentially dictated by the size of the anion or nonpolar domain volumes ,, depending of the nature of the metal precursor (ionic or neutral), , and different shapes can be obtained (Figure ). Immobilization of MNPs in ILs can also be obtained by transfer between phases …”

“…When aiming to create materials with specific shapes or chemical compositions, Ionic liquids can function both as precursors and as templates or reactive media. Ionic liquids reactions create a conducive ionic environment for the synthesis of novel structured materials, imparting them with unique and beneficial properties [35]. Recent studies indicate that employing ionic liquids instead of conventional organic or aqueous solvents enables the production of nanoparticles without requiring external capping agents [36].…”
